     Your Committee on Ways and Means, to which was referred S.B. No. 2766, S.D. 1, entitled:

 

"A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O THE EMPLOYEES' RETIREMENT SYSTEM,"

 

begs leave to report as follows:

 

     The purpose and intent of this measure is to clarify that the trust assets of the Employees' Retirement System are to be expended exclusively for the benefit of its members and their beneficiaries.

 

     Specifically, this measure specifies that benefits for a service-connected disability or accidental death be limited to members who are beneficiaries of the trust.

 

     Your Committee received written comments in support of this measure from the Employees' Retirement System.

 

     Your Committee finds in Stout v. Board of Trustees of the Employees' Retirement System, 140 Haw. 177, 398 P.3d 766 (2017), the Hawaii Supreme Court held that under certain circumstances, a person who sustains an injury while performing government service for which contributions to the Employees' Retirement System are not required could, nonetheless, qualify for Employees' Retirement System benefits.  Your Committee finds that this measure will clarify that claims for benefits related to service-connected disability and accidental death benefits are limited to members who are beneficiaries of the trust.
